Cost of Hill Removal in Greeley

Zip

Removing hills or leveling land in Greeley, CO, can be a significant undertaking, involving various factors that influence the overall cost. Whether you are preparing a site for construction, landscaping, or agricultural purposes, understanding the costs involved can help you plan your budget effectively.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Hill: Larger hills require more work and resources to remove, increasing the overall cost.
  • Type of Soil: Different soil types can affect the ease of removal and the equipment needed.
  • Accessibility: Hard-to-reach locations may require specialized equipment and additional labor.
  • Disposal of Removed Material: The cost of transporting and disposing of the removed soil and debris can add to the total expense.
  • Permits and Regulations: Local regulations and the need for permits can influence the cost and timeline of the project.
  • Labor Costs: The rates charged by local labor can vary and impact the total cost.

Common Tasks and Costs

Task Average Cost in Greeley, CO
Initial Site Assessment $100 - $300
Soil Testing $200 - $500
Excavation $1,500 - $5,000 per acre
Grading and Leveling $1,000 - $3,000 per acre
Disposal of Soil and Debris $300 - $1,000 per load
Permit Fees $50 - $200

Understanding these factors and common costs can help you prepare for a hill removal project in Greeley, CO, ensuring that you have a clear idea of what to expect financially.
